网站数量呈爆炸式增长,网站性能成为影响用户体验的关键因素。而CSS作为网页样式表的重要部分,其压缩对于提升网站性能具有重要意义。本文将从CSS压缩的意义、方法、工具等方面进行探讨,以帮助读者更好地了解CSS压缩。

一、CSS压缩的意义

1. 减少文件大小:CSS压缩可以删除文件中的空白字符、注释等,从而减小文件大小,降低网络传输时间。

2. 提高加载速度:文件越小,浏览器加载所需时间越短,从而提高网站加载速度,提升用户体验。

压缩CSS提升网站性能的利器

3. 优化缓存:压缩后的CSS文件在缓存中占用空间更小,有利于减少重复加载,提高网站性能。

4. 提高搜索引擎排名:搜索引擎优化(SEO)是网站运营的重要环节,压缩CSS文件有助于提高网站在搜索引擎中的排名。

二、CSS压缩的方法

1. 手动压缩:通过编辑CSS文件,删除空白字符、注释等,实现CSS压缩。这种方法适用于对CSS有一定了解的开发者。

2. 使用在线工具:在线CSS压缩工具可以帮助开发者快速压缩CSS文件。例如,CSS Minifier、CSS Compressor等。

3. 使用插件:许多代码编辑器都支持CSS压缩插件,如Visual Studio Code、Sublime Text等。通过安装插件,开发者可以在编辑过程中自动压缩CSS文件。

4. 使用构建工具:构建工具如Webpack、Gulp等可以集成CSS压缩功能,实现自动化压缩。这种方法适用于大型项目,提高开发效率。

三、CSS压缩工具推荐

1. CSS Minifier:这是一个在线CSS压缩工具,支持多种压缩选项,操作简单,效果显著。

2. CSS Compressor:同样是一个在线CSS压缩工具,支持多种压缩方式,压缩效果较好。

3. UglifyCSS:这是一个JavaScript库,用于压缩CSS文件。它支持多种压缩选项,可以满足不同需求。

4. PostCSS:PostCSS是一个强大的CSS工具链,可以集成多种插件,实现CSS压缩、自动前缀、代码格式化等功能。

CSS压缩是提升网站性能的重要手段,通过减少文件大小、提高加载速度、优化缓存等途径,为用户提供更好的使用体验。本文从CSS压缩的意义、方法、工具等方面进行了探讨,希望对读者有所帮助。在开发过程中,合理运用CSS压缩技术,让网站运行更高效、更流畅。